Including “breadcrumb” links on your website’s pages can improve navigation – and search engine performance, too. “Breadcrumbs” are text links that show visitors their current location in a site’s hierarchy, e.g., “home >>products >>boats >>inflatable.” Not only will your website visitors appreciate the assistance, search engines will also pick up a few more possible search terms when they index “breadcrumbs”.

Live by the rule that no page on your site should be more than two clicks away from your home page. Search engines hate deep links and often times ignore them. As well, by sticking to this rule, you help guarantee that all of your pages get to enjoy some residual page rank value from your home page.

When you start a blog associated with your website, put it under the same domain name as your main site if at all possible. If your blog attracts attention other bloggers or online writers may link to it. Then, if your blog shares a domain with your website, links to the blog will improve the main site’s position on search engine indexes.
